3.2 Current state
This page layout shows the work state of VoIP phone.
The network part shows the connection state of WAN
interface and LAN interface and the network setting; the
work state of Public SIP service of VoIP part, and here
you can see the registration and whether registered to
the server or not. The Phone Number part shows the
telephone numbers in Private SIP server and Public
SIP server.
3.3 Network
3.3.1 Wan Config
WAN port network setting page.
Support static IP, dynamic obtain IP and PPPoE.
Configure Static IP
- Enable Static;
- Set 3300IPs IP address in the IP Address;
- Set netmask in the Netmask field;
- Set router IP address in the Gateway;
- DNS Domain:
- Set local DNS server in the Preferred DNS and
the Alternate DNS
Configure to dynamic obtain IP
Enable DHCP;
If there is DHCP server in your local network, 3300IP
will automatically obtain WAN port network information
from your DHCP server.
Configure PPPoE:
- Enable PPPoE
- PPPoE server: Enter ANYif no specified from
your ITSP.
- Enter PPPoE username and pin in the username
and password.
3300IP will automatically obtain WAN port network
information from your ITSP if PPPoE setting and the
setup are correct. Notice: If user accesses the IP
phone through WAN port. He/She should use the new
IP address to access the IP phone when the WAN port
address was changed.
3.3.2 LAN Config$
LAN IP Netmask: Set the IP Netmask for the LAN
DHCP Server: Enable DHCP service in LAN port;
after user changed LAN IP, phone will automatically
modify DHCP Lease Table and save the configure
according to IP and netmask, DHCP server configure
wont take effect unless you reboot the device.
NAT: Enable NAT.
Bridge Mode: Enable this option to switch to bridge
mode. IP phone wont assign IP for its LAN port in
bridge mode and its LAN and WAN port will be in the
same network. (This setting wont take effect unless
you save the config and reboot the device)
